Flights
Hotels
KLUB
Recommended
Experiences
Recommended
Car Rentals
Recommended
Package Tours
Promotions
Recommended
Home
Hotels
Thailand
Nakhon Si Thammarat
Muang Nakhon Si Thammarat
laekhon-nonbai
laekhon-nonbai
4.0
(5 review)
•
56/2 Naimuang, Muang Nakhon Si Thammarat, Nakhon Si Thammarat, Thailand 80000